The universe is ruled by gods, their dominion upheld by the vast reach of the Divine Federation. For millennia, they have shaped history, silencing those who dare to defy them. But when the Celestial Realignment begins, ripples of change spread across the cosmos, awakening ancient empires, stirring forgotten legacies, and unearthing forces that should have remained buried. All eyes turn toward a seemingly insignificant planet—Terra—where destiny is quietly unfolding.

Caught in the heart of this cosmic storm are Leonard Haravok and Samantha McCoy—two souls bound together in ways neither fully understands. Leon seeks vengeance for a past that will not let him go, while Sam, burdened by guilt, longs for connection in a life shaped by solitude. As the tides of war rise, their paths become inexorably intertwined, testing not only their strength but the fragile emotions neither dares to name.

In the chaos, alliances will be forged, betrayals will cut deep, and amidst the fire of war, hearts may find themselves entangled in ways neither fate nor duty could predict.

The Age of False Gods is ending. But what comes next may be far more dangerous.

    Very interesting story, I thought the synopsis/blurb could've been crafted better. The story overall was very good, I haven't read a lot of sword wielder stories so when I read this it was really interesting and to the point. Although the pace was a little fast, I think for someone reading webnovel it will catch their attention quickly. The paragraphs are not spaced well enough in my opinion, some are too long and they strained my eyes. Perhaps you can look into that in future chapters.  Speaking of which, the paywall was a little too quick. I wouldn't recommend paywalling it that much unless you plan to write less than a hundred chapters. The writing was good, but sometimes the narrative slipped, like switching from the third-person perspective to the writer's/narrator's. There were no grammar or punctuation mistakes so far, but the use of passive voice was overrated, it got annoying to keep reading them. Perhaps balance them, but otherwise. I can't comment on the worldbuilding yet, but so far, so good. Avoid the info-dumping though, it won't help with a smooth narrative. The characters, Keven and Greg maybe, they sound and feel 2d, not real human. But maybe that was the author's intention to develop them further. the updates seem to be frequent and the development of the story is good enough, so I would say this deserves a 4/5 stars. Kudos to the author and happy reading!
